<p>So, let&#8217;s take a few lessons from Uncle Josh.</p>
<p><strong>Here are a handful of tips that I like to use BEFORE jumping head-first into a new business decision </strong>(and I love to take risks, but even I know better when it comes to the current economic situation):</p>
<blockquote><p>1.<strong> If you can say &#8220;NO&#8221; and walk away from any deal, then you will pay less and have the upper hand in the situation</strong>. Never walk into a deal where your mouth is watering and you are jumping up and down to hand out your money.</p>
<p>2. <strong>Time limits don&#8217;t apply.</strong> If a person is trying to tell you that you can&#8217;t get that same price after a certain time period, try offering them the money the next day, AFTER you&#8217;ve gained a cool head. I bet they don&#8217;t turn you down.</p>
<p>3. <strong>If the seller is trying to rush you, run the other way</strong>. The deal is too good to be true.</p>
<p>4. <strong>Never hire someone for something that you can outsource with a subcontractor</strong>. Employees are a total pain in the arse and a drain on your sanity.</p>
<p>5. <strong>Give it the old rule of &#8220;24&#8243;</strong>. Basically, that means sleep on it. There is nothing that you have to buy right NOW that will make your business that much better. If you feel like you have to buy it right now, then the seller has the upper hand.</p>
<p>6. <strong>Don&#8217;t poop on your own couch</strong>- or in nicer terms that my mom would approve of (since she&#8217;s reading this), it means NEVER burn bridges with people whom you do business with.</p>
<p>7. <strong>Buy used</strong>. Most fancy-schmancy things can be purchased for pennies on the dollar when you buy them after that &#8220;new car&#8221; smell has worn off. No one will know the difference, and the money you save in the long run can put you in a higher tax bracket.</p>
<p>8. <strong>Diversification does not mean buying different versions of the same thing</strong>. It makes me throw up when people try to give out the worn-out advice from investing that says you should &#8220;diversify&#8221; with small cap, large cap, and medium cap stocks, bond funds etc. It&#8217;s all the same thing. TRUE diversification means that you have money coming on from totally different sources, such as your business, investments, real estate, side businesses etc.</p></blockquote>

</p><p>There&#8217;s a new trend emerging across the country in the world of skateboarding. These guys are now taking huge, blue painter&#8217;s tarps and &#8220;surfing&#8221; through them on skate boards in large parking lots.</p>
<p>If you want to see videos of this, they&#8217;re all over the Internet.</p>
<p>Now, on the surface, this looks pretty lame, but these guys are causing the sales of giant tarps to fly off the shelves in many cities, and you&#8217;ll probably see this in a parking lot near you within the next year.</p>
<p>What in the Sam Hill does skateboarding on a tarp in the parking lot of a local grocery store have to do with your business? <strong>EVERYTHING</strong>.</p>
<p>Why?</p>
<p>This is about <strong>re-purposing</strong> your product, content, or services. Surfers wanted a way to keep surfing even when there weren&#8217;t any waves. They invented the skateboard. Skateboarders got bored and wanted to pretend there was a huge wave in the parking lot of the local Winn-Dixie&#8230; so they whipped out the big, blue tarps.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s about taking something that you&#8217;ve already created and breathing new life into it.</p>
<ul>
<blockquote>
<li>Drug makers do this all the time.</li>
<li>Bloggers re-purpose content and create e-books from it.</li>
<li>Service providers can take a certain skill they have and bring it to a whole new industry.</li>
</blockquote>
</ul>
<p>When times are tough, <strong>re-purposing your existing products</strong>, even &#8220;sleeper&#8221; products that aren&#8217;t selling so well, can be a huge money maker for you and can be just what your small business needs in a tough economy.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s really time-consuming to invent something new. It&#8217;s also very risky. You already have an expertise, so why not milk that knowledge for all it&#8217;s worth.</p>

<p><strong>Here&#8217;s the deal:</strong></p>
<p>Find 2-3 successful businesses that are outside of your current niche. If you are a lawyer, go for the chiropractor. If you sell a health product, go for the company selling collectibles. The idea here is that you want to mix it up a little bit.</p>
<p>When companies in one niche are all doing the same thing, selling with the same technique, selling the same product to the same folks&#8230; well, guess what? </p>
<p><strong>They all get the same results.</strong></p>
<blockquote><p> If you&#8217;re just following along with your &#8220;industry standard,&#8221; then there is no way for your business to get ahead of the pack. You have to go a different route and pick a slightly different strategy.</p></blockquote>
<p>&#8230;an <strong>Underdog Millionaire</strong> strategy.</p>
<p>Once you have your 2-3 businesses selected, this is where all of the magic is boing to happen. Call them up and act as if you are a buyer. Get them to take you through their entire sales process, even send you follow-up information in the mail.</p>
<p>Take as many notes as your little fingers can manage. Even better, record the call with a digital voice recorder.</p>
<ul>
<li>You can do this with infomercials (hint: Bowflex has one of the best sales systems out there, but be careful- they may talk you into buying one&#8230;)</li>
<li>You can do this with service businesses</li>
<li>You can even do this with your local dry cleaner</li>
</ul>
<p>Call upon any successful business in a non-related niche and have them walk you through their sales process as you act like a tough customer.</p>
<p>Sales school in a box.</p>
<p>Just make sure that you don&#8217;t take too much advantage of this process and definitely don&#8217;t rip-off their process completely. Just take the best parts and make them your own.</p>
<p><strong>Some things to pay attention to:</strong></p>
<ul>
<li>How many rebuttal speeches do they have?</li>
<li>How is their sales process organized?</li>
<li>How many people do you talk to?</li>
<li>Do you get voicemail at any time, or talk to a live person first?</li>
<li>How long did they keep you on the phone?</li>
<li>How many follow-up mailings did they send?</li>
<li>Did they change the mailing slightly, or mail you the same thing repeatedly?</li>
</ul>
<p>Just by going through this exercise and then adapting these great processes to your own business, you can attract more customers and bring in more sales than you ever thought possible.</p>
<p>&#8230;all without having to crack open a book or attend a single class.</p>

<p>First, let&#8217;s take a ride in the Way Back<br />
Machine and look at the traditional advice<br />
for launching a product.</p>
<p>The idea is that you should create a list<br />
of prospects, slowly build up hype over time,<br />
and then for a very limited time, you offer<br />
a huge discount to that group of people that<br />
got on the list and raised their hands to show<br />
interest.</p>
<p>Now, this works in the short run, don&#8217;t get<br />
me wrong here.</p>
<p>The problem is that once the intro offer is<br />
over and your price goes back up to full<br />
price, all of those people that were on<br />
the intro list and didn&#8217;t buy, will probably<br />
never buy.</p>
<p>This is because they now see the price<br />
increasing from the low level of before.</p>
<p>You have now lost that customer and a lot<br />
more to go along with it.</p>
<p>You get a quick boost of cash in the short<br />
run, and then everyone will forget about your<br />
product due to the increase in price.</p>
<p>Take the U.S. Government as an example. There<br />
have been many techniques to try and stimulate<br />
the current economy, one being a huge rebate<br />
of $8,000 for first time home buyers.</p>
<p>Now, this rebate created a huge influx of<br />
people buying homes, but once that rebate program<br />
was over, home sales dropped like a cinder block<br />
being thrown off a freeway bridge.</p>
<p>So where in the heck am I going with this?</p>
<p>When you launch a new product or service, you<br />
should still generate all the buzz in the world.</p>
<p>Your product won&#8217;t sell without you going out<br />
there and banging two trashcan lids together,<br />
making a ton of noise and generating interest.</p>
<p>But&#8230; <strong>be REALLY careful when it comes to your<br />
pricing.</strong></p>
<blockquote><p>If you want to generate a substantial, long-term<br />
business with your product, skip the deep discounts.</p></blockquote>
<p>Offer one-time bonuses to early buyers, or some<br />
other incentive that can be packaged with the<br />
product or service, but don&#8217;t cut the price<br />
and then raise it.</p>
<p>Otherwise you are going to develop a business<br />
that can only survive on a consistent string<br />
of product launching and that can be exhausting<br />
for you, the owner, and for your customers.</p>
